On UB

BB showed KK when folding. Good play on her part??



Ultimate Bet 15/30 Hold'em (6 handed) converter

Preflop: Hero is MP with T, A.
UTG calls, Hero raises, 1 fold, Button calls, 1 fold, BB 3-bets, UTG folds, Hero calls, Button calls.

Flop: (10.66 SB) A, J, 6 (3 players)
BB bets, Hero raises, Button folds, BB folds.

Final Pot: 6.83 BB

Results in white below:
No showdown. Hero wins 6.83 BB.

Given you raised UTG+1 then called the 3bet this almost seems like an Ace face, when the A hits the flop she gave you credit for the A, personally I’m not sure if it was the "right lay down" but I do know she had a good read on your hand... really she made a big lay down, where it might have been profitable to check call the flop there? given that the pot preflop was 9.5sb and then 10.5sb where if she has a spade she has about 1/2 the value of a flush draw 4.5 plus 2 Ks so 6.5 outs, which is about 7.1:1 plus implied odds of probably at least 2bb out of you, so given the pot of 14.5sb (including implied), 7.1:1 a profitable call?

PF (3 way 3 bet + sb): 9.5sb
Flop: your bet 10.5sb
Implied sb: 4
Total 14.5sb = 7.25bb
Given KsKh = about 7.1:1

I think you might want to gamble there... close decision...

Hi Pokerfanatic

Yes, it was interesting,. I don't know , though, if checking the flop is reasoable for her after she 3 bet. One option may have been to check with the intention of a C/R, but then I would just have slowed down and called down. So I don't like the C/R either.

I think the boarded ace and the three spades combined was enough for her to think she was not going to get sucked out. I doubt she wold have folded the same board rainbow instead of spades.

I think the lay down is a good play but not the right one by her if one of her kings was the spade. I check/call to the turn and see what drops here every time. i want to see a spade or a K because I am reasonably sure that you have Ace face...i will draw against you for my set/flush. Especially when the flush is the nuts.

If she doesnt have the spade...Easy fold.
